用手機對WIFI模組進行配置

2021-10-02 01:52:13 字數 1515 閱讀 4543

ap:即無線接入點,是乙個無線網路的中心節點。通常使用的無線路由器就是乙個ap,其它無線終端可以通過ap相互連線。

sta:即無線站點,是乙個無線網路的終端。如膝上型電腦、pda等。

48899埠:我所用的wifi模組(usr-wifi232-s)的埠 

49000埠:除去我用的wifi(usr-wifi232-s)模組,其他wifi模組的埠

使用udp廣播方式搜尋wifi模組

第一階段: 

模組工作在ap模式下時,會開啟乙個用於接收「快速聯網協議命令」的udp埠,埠號為48999(出廠設定預設ip為10.10.100.254)

收到模組返回的ip位址及mac位址後,立即回送乙個「+ok」,模組收到後進入連線狀態。

進入連線狀態後,模組可以正常接收網路at指令。 如:設定網路協議引數:at+netp=tcp,client,30000,x.x.x.x 設定sta的網路引數:at+wann=dhcp

過渡階段:

udp廣播(埠:49000)傳送指令ff 00 01 01 02(十六進製制)

模組收到指令後返回路由列表

將使用者選擇的ssid(路由名稱)和金鑰傳送給模組(埠:49000),模組連入此路由,轉化成sta模式,並回送乙個指令ff 00 03 82 01 01 87

第二階段:在sta模式下,我們要找到此wifi模組,並對其傳送開、關等操作指令。步驟同第一階段,但是返回的ip位址會不一樣。模組作為sta鏈結到路由中,以為此時模組的ip位址是由路由器分配的,不是確定ip位址,所以手機無法與模組建立連線,故需要採用廣播搜尋,獲取到模組在sta模式下的位址。

有了基本的思路,了解並熟悉整個連線和通訊過程,接下來就是比較簡單的和基礎的部分了,包括udp通訊以及字元和十六進製制之間的轉換等基本功了。整個開發過程中,對以上內容的理解是一點一點來的,剛開始組長給我講一遍什麼都不明白,給了我一堆資料和工具也不知道怎麼用,但是開發著開發著就搞清楚了。開發過程中還請教了wifi模組生產公司的工程師,解決了我的問題。遇到問題時,還是要多想辦法,總會有解決的辦法,看你有沒有決心和信心要把它解決出來。

用手機對電腦進行遠端關機

ps 本人一月份寫的文章,貼在這裡。昨天真是奔波的一天,中午烤肉逛街下午壽司看電影 陪老婆 今天中午又是麻辣 額,不爭氣的腸胃果然導致我拉肚子了。不過,話說昨天下午在石景山萬達吃完壽司後,看了 金陵十三釵 倒是頗有感觸,這部電影 又名 保衛戰 旗幟鮮明的打出了這樣口號 讓 先走。老謀子的電影越來越不...

wifi 模組 配置

自從物聯網 問世以來,如何使得物 能夠聯網 有了很多的方式,目前運用非常廣的wifi,今天就總結下自這個方面,也對於有需要的盆友 也希望有拋磚引玉之效果。1 ti 的smartconfig 此時 該區域網內一般有三個裝置 wifi晶元工作在ap模式 或者是ap station模式 手機 智慧型硬體s...

WIFI模組連線手機

配置wifi模組ap at cwsap esp8266 12345678 3,4 設定ap的ssid為 esp8266 密碼12345678,最後兩個引數3和4分別表示通道和加密方式。手機連上模組的wifi。at cwlif可檢視當前連線到ap的客戶端列表。at cifsr查詢本機ip位址.配置wi...